Isn't this a cute card??? The body is the 1 3/4" ciclre punch, the head is the 1 3/8" circle punch, and the ears are small ovals. The pom pom is stuck on with a mini glue dot.
Next we made the Easter bunny baskets. This basket is super simple. Start with a 6" X 6" square scored on all sides at 2" and 4". We then put squares of designer series paper on the corner squares and formed our basket. The handle is held on by brads. The Easter Bunny is made from punches again. The face is the wide oval, ears are the large and small ovals, cheeks are the 1/2" circle, and eyes and nose are the 1/4" circle. We filled them with Easter grass and chocolate eggs of course.

This card is much more involved and they got to stamp, use markers, punches, ribbon, and my Big Shot!! They used the texturz plates with the big shot to get the embossed design on the Cameo Coral piece. They stamped Tempting Turquoise and Lovely Lilac with Itty Bitty Backgrounds on the white strip. The chick is from A Good Egg, and they used the scallop edge punch on the Certainly Celery! They were all able to make them, and they turned out really cute! Well here, judge for yourself:
